Quick Facts
-
Typically made with hard‑wearing frames (solid hardwood or engineered timber).
-
Filled with high‑grade foam, feathers, or pocket springs for enduring comfort.
-
Upholstery ranges from luxury velvet and linen to premium leather and bouclé.
-
Designed to provide excellent support and lasting shape.
-
Often handcrafted or finished with meticulous attention to detail.
-
Available in a variety of sizes, from two‑seater to large modular options.

Popular Styles
-
Classic Scroll Arm: Traditional silhouette with a reassuringly plush feel.
-
Mid‑Century Modern: Clean lines, tapered legs, and minimal detailing.
-
Modular Sectionals: Flexible seating layouts perfect for modern living.
-
Chesterfield‑Inspired: Deep tufting and rich upholstery for heritage appeal.
-
Contemporary Low‑Profile: Sleek, understated, and effortlessly chic.
How to Choose
Selecting a top quality sofa in the UK involves balancing comfort, scale, and lifestyle needs:
-
Size and Proportion: Measure your room and ensure the sofa doesn’t dwarf or underwhelm the space. Leave comfortable circulation space around it.
-
Upholstery Type: Choose fabrics that suit your daily life — velvets for luxury and depth; linens for lightness; leathers for durability.
-
Frame Strength: Look for robust timber frames and quality joinery that withstand years of use.
-
Comfort Level: Test the seat depth, cushion firmness, and back support to match your comfort preference.
-
Colour Palette: Consider your existing décor — neutrals for timeless versatility or bold tones for impact.

Common Questions
Q: What qualifies a sofa as “top quality”?
A: A combination of strong frame construction, high‑grade upholstery, thoughtful design, and enduring comfort.
Q: How long should a well‑made sofa last?
A: With proper care, a top quality sofa can remain comfortable and stylish for a decade or more.
Q: Are certain fabrics better for family homes?
A: Yes — durable linens, treated velvets, and quality leathers resist wear and are easier to maintain.
Q: Should I prioritise comfort or design?
A: It’s best to choose a sofa that delivers both; comfort ensures daily use, while design elevates your space.
Q: Can top quality sofas be customised?
A: Many makers offer custom upholstery, dimensions, or cushion options to suit personal needs.
